What happens when a few of Canada's most in-demand session musicians decide to create something new? You get 'THE HELLO DARLINS'.
The Hello Darlins is an award winning collective of artists and special guests. Led by Mike Little, Murray Pulver, Candace Lacina and a powerhouse cast, the band combines all of their skills and influences to forge a distinct hybrid of country, gospel and blues like no other. Their work with artists includes a list that ranges from Shania Twain, The Crashtest Dummies, as well as the late B.B. King and more.
With their debut Album “Go By Feel” released June 2021, The Darlins have quickly risen to international acclaim. The album charted at Number 4 on The Euro Americana Charts and was the feature album for ABC Country Music Australia.
